First Official Match

The first official international meeting between Afghanistan and West Indies took place on 27 March 2016 during the ICC World Twenty20 in Nagpur.

Afghanistan made 123/7 after being asked to bat first. Najibullah Zadran played the decisive innings with 48 from 40 balls. West Indies reached 117/8 in reply, giving Afghanistan a famous six-run victory.

Historic Test Matches

The Test rivalry has only one completed match so far.

Afghanistan and West Indies played their first Test against each other in November 2019 at Lucknow. It was also an important milestone for Afghanistan’s Test development.

DateVenueAfghanistanWest IndiesResult
27 Nov 2019Lucknow187 & 120277 & 33/1West Indies won by 9 wickets

West Indies controlled the match after taking a substantial first-innings lead. Their bowlers then completed the job in Afghanistan’s second innings before the chase was finished with minimal loss.

This remains the only official Test meeting between the two sides.

Historic ODI Matches

The ODI rivalry became more competitive during the 2017 series in the Caribbean. Afghanistan won the opening match by 63 runs, West Indies responded in the second, and the third match ended without a result.

Important ODI Results

DateVenueResult
10 Jun 2017Gros IsletAfghanistan won by 63 runs
12 Jun 2017Gros IsletWest Indies won by 4 wickets
15 Jun 2017Gros IsletNo result
15 Mar 2018HarareAfghanistan won by 3 wickets
25 Mar 2018HarareAfghanistan won by 7 wickets
4 Jul 2019LeedsWest Indies won by 23 runs
6 Nov 2019LucknowWest Indies won by 7 wickets
9 Nov 2019LucknowWest Indies won by 47 runs
11 Nov 2019LucknowWest Indies won by 5 wickets

Across the nine completed/recorded ODI meetings listed in current head-to-head records, West Indies have won five, Afghanistan three, with one no-result.

Recent Encounters

The most recent bilateral series was the three-match T20I series in January 2026 in the UAE.

DateMatchAfghanistanWest IndiesResult
19 Jan 20261st T20I181/3143/9Afghanistan won by 38 runs
21 Jan 20262nd T20I189/4150Afghanistan won by 39 runs
22 Jan 20263rd T20I138/8151/7West Indies won by 13 runs

Afghanistan therefore won the series 2-1. The series was arranged as part of both teams’ preparations for the 2026 T20 World Cup.

The third match was particularly close. Afghanistan scored 138/8, but West Indies chased successfully with 151/7 to prevent a series clean sweep.
